Menopause is a natural transition in a woman's life indicated by the cessation of menstruation. During this phase, hormonal fluctuations can cause a wide range of symptoms that can affect a woman's physical and emotional well-being. Some common symptoms include flushes, perspiration during sleep, thinning of vaginal tissues, irritability, and trouble falling or staying asleep. These symptoms can vary in severity from woman to woman and may be persistent over time.

It's important to acknowledge that menopause is a normal part of aging, and its symptoms do not necessarily signify illness. However, if symptoms are prolonged, it's essential to speak with a healthcare provider to explore management strategies. They can help assess the underlying causes of your symptoms and develop a personalized plan to improve your quality of life during this transition.

Journeying the Perimenopausal Transition: A Guide to Changes

Perimenopause is a period of transition in a woman's life marked by hormonal changes. It can last for several years, leading to a range of both physical and emotional symptoms. Understanding these transformations is key to successfully navigating this period. Some common experiences include irregular periods, temperature swings, sleep disturbances, and mood swings.

It's important to remember that every woman's perimenopause is unique. Some women experience mild symptoms, while others face more pronounced challenges. Discussing your doctor is crucial for obtaining personalized guidance and exploring potential treatment options.

  • Habitual changes can play a positive role in managing perimenopausal experiences.
  • Consistent exercise can help regulate hormones and improve mood.
  • A healthy di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ains can provide essential nutrients.
  • Stress management practices such as yoga or meditation can be advantageous.

Hormonal Imbalances

Menopause is a natural biological process that signifies the end of a woman's reproductive years. It's characterized by significant variations in hormone production, primarily estrogen and progesterone. These fluctuations can lead to a variety of physical and emotional manifestations. Frequently reported among these are hot flashes, night sweats, difficulty sleeping, vaginal dryness, mood swings, and irritability.

It's important to understand that these challenges are not simply a part of aging but rather the direct result of hormonal disruptions. Managing these imbalances is crucial for women to navigate menopause more comfortably.

Managing Hot Flashes, Mood Swings, and Other Menopausal Challenges

Menopause is a natural transition transition in a woman's life, marked by hormonal changes that can lead to a variety of symptoms. Some common challenges include hot flashes, mood swings, sleep disturbances, and vaginal dryness. Fortunately, there are many effective strategies for managing these symptoms and improving your well-being during this time.

It's essential to discuss with your doctor about your individual experiences and develop a personalized plan. They can recommend lifestyle modifications, such as regular exercise, stress management techniques, and a healthy diet, which can significantly alleviate menopausal symptoms. In some cases, hormone therapy may be appropriate to address more intense symptoms.

Remember that menopause is a unique journey for every woman. Tune in to your body, seek support from loved ones and healthcare professionals, and embrace this new chapter with empowerment.
